Barcelona president Joan Gaspart has rejected Lazio’s offer to swap their unsettled midfielder Gaizka Mendieta with Barcelona’s Brazilian striker Rivaldo.

Former Valencia skipper Mendieta, who has flopped since his £27million move to Italy, has been deemed surplus to requirements by Sergio Cragnotti, president of cash-strapped Lazio.

However, h is hopes of negotiating an exchange deal for Rivaldo have suffered a setback with the news that Barcelona are not interested in signing Mendieta.

“I am not interested in a swap deal”, the Catalan president stated, thus refuting reports over the weekend that the clubs were discussing a deal.

Gaspart also denied that full-back Carles Puyol was on the move. Real Madrid and Manchester United had both been linked with the international defender, but Gaspart claims the player is staying put.

“He still has two years on his current contract. It gives us time to negociate”, Gaspart said.
